WebJun 11, 2024 · 10. Support Muscle Growth. Salmon roe is an excellent source of protein, offering 25 grams of protein per 100 grams of roe. Of the 25 gram, approx 2g is an essential anabolic (muscle building) amino acid called leucine. Leucine is necessary for the stimulation of mTOR, which regulates muscle growth. WebMar 6, 2024 · While all of Scandinavia has cod, Norway is home to the largest stocks of the “white gold” in the world. Cod has been credited with shaping the nation and king among them is the migratory skrei – a Norwegian-Arctic cod that travels from the Barents Sea to the Lofoten Islands to reproduce.. WebFeb 28, 2012 · The preserved fish roe is also a base for various dishes, mainly fritters. In Volos and Mt. Pelion, in central Greece, tarama fritters contain fresh oregano; in Chios and other eastern Aegean islands, home cooks make a fritter with wild fennel and tarama, called malathropites. Contemporary chefs are experimenting with the roe as a sauce. WebSep 20, 2024 · Combine hot water together with salt. Once the salt is dissolved, add salted water to the fish eggs and leave eggs soaking with salt water for 70 seconds. Strain out the water from eggs and place them in a glass jar, add oil to the eggs. You can keep them in a refrigerator for up to two weeks.
